Output 50ecc637c24de4e692c8386cc7a067d1b89abb7b6b8c7e51616327f64bdb1f34:0

value
1907946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7301b436c64e94dec30b4773ed3e04a9a329d3d8 OP_EQUAL
address
3CB7fzovVWKh442uBGgKnJ2yVLmmS77gx7
transaction
50ecc637c24de4e692c8386cc7a067d1b89abb7b6b8c7e51616327f64bdb1f34
spent
true